Mount Elgon National Park is a 4,321m high extinct volcano with Wagagai as its highest peak, that first erupted more than 24 million years ago and in prehistoric times stood taller than Kilimanjaro does today. Having a 50km by 80km area, Elgon is a great Uganda safari destination, possessing the largest surface area of any extinct Volcano in the world but 4th highest mount in E. Africa. This mountain straddles the Kenya border, but its highest peak Wagagai peak,( 4321 m), lies within Uganda and is best ascended from the Uganda side. Elgon also contains collapsed crater-Calder covering over 40kms at the top and it is the largest known crater, surrounded by a series of rugged peaks.

Hiking Mount Elgon National Park

The main tourist attraction for hikers on this relatively undemanding mountain, is its spectacular scenery, the Mountain Elgon area also offers to sight a variety of unique forest monkeys and small antelopes, along with huge elephants and buffaloes. The unique Sipi Falls, ancient enormous stone-age cave paintings close to the Budadiri trail head, the scenic mountain peaks, the hot springs that bubble up at 4800c and gorges are to mention but some of the thrilling attraction the Elgon area has to offer.

Sipi Falls Hike

Sipi Falls is located a few kilometers from Mbale, en-route to the Forest Exploration Centre and Kapkwata. Several trails in the area allow for intriguing day hikes through friendly local villages and beautiful farming country.

Seven rock-climbing routes are open at Nagudi rock, half-way between Mbale and Budadili. The routes are bolted, but climbers must bring their own rock-climbing equipment. Each climber pays to the local Parish treasurer.

Camping at Mount Elgon National Park

The Elgon area has nine basic campsites to offer, located at strategic points along the trekking routes. Camping should only be done at designated campsites and tourists are advised to carry along with them all the required camping equipment.
